>SmackDown and Subway present WWE No Mercy
>Baltimore, MD
>1st Mariner Arena
>
>Official Theme Song: "Today is the Day" by Dope
>
>1...  WWE cruiserweight champion Tajiri (12'05" kick -> pin) Rey Mysterio
>

Excellent opener.

>2...  Chris Benoit (12'21" Crippler crossface) A-Train
>

Sharpshooter, not crossface.

VERY good match, and wins the scary spot of the month award when
A--Train's hand slipped and he dropped Benoit on his head.

Is anyone else starting to see the same results with A-Train's long
feud w/Benoit that we saw with Booker T after the best-of-seven series
in WCW?  Albert's always tried hard, but he seems to be putting it
together for only the 2nd time in his career (the 1st to me was when
he feuded with Kane for the IC title).

>6...  Kurt Angle (18'24" anklelock) John Cena
>

VERY good.  I'm waiting for the rematch(es).

>7...  Big Show (11'22" chokeslam -> pin) Eddie Guerrero
>      Show wins WWE U.S. championship
>

Ugh.  Eddie tried... I guess the cuts on his back are from the glass
ceiling, not the lowrider.  SOMEONE obviously doesn't want him to be a
breakout star.  :-/

>8...  Biker Chain Match
>      WWE Champion Brock Lesnar (24'20") Undertaker
>

Again, ugh.  I was expecting the rest of the heel lockerroom to run
out and help roll 'Taker into a coffin like they did years ago.

Overall, a show that will be remembered as average at best (despite
the 3 excellent matches) because all the goodwill of the viewing
public was sucked away by the final 2 matches and their finishes.
